site stats

Permutation swaps gfg

WebLargest Permutation Practice GeeksforGeeks Given a permutation of first n natural numbers as an array and an integer k. Print the lexicographically largest permutation after …

Previous Permutation With One Swap - LeetCode

WebThe task is to apply at most one swap operation on the number N so that the result is just a previous possible number. Note: Leading zeros are not allowed. Example 1: Input : S = Problems Courses Get Hired; Contests. GFG Weekly Coding Contest. Job-a-Thon: Hiring Challenge. BiWizard School Contest. Gate CS Scholarship Test. Solving for India ... WebGiven a number K and string str of digits denoting a positive integer, build the largest number possible by performing swap operations on the digits of str at most K times. Example 1: Input: K = 4 str = "1234567" Output: 7654321 Explanation: Three swaps can make the input 1234567 to 7654321, swapping 1 with 7, 2 with 6 and finally 3 with 5 dundee train station to ninewells hospital https://bassfamilyfarms.com

Largest Permutation Practice GeeksforGeeks

WebNov 18, 2024 · We swap 4 with 1, and 2 with 3 requiring a minimum of 2 swaps. Input 2: a = [1, 5, 4, 3, 2] Output 2: 2 Explanation 2: We swap 5 with 2 and 4 with 3 requiring a minimum of 2 swaps. Approach 1 (Graph-Based Approach) This problem can be solved quite easily if we change our perspective and try to model this problem into a graph problem. WebMay 19,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ebI am working as Software Engineer 2 at Walmart Global Tech India. A channel to make people fall in love with Data structures and Algorithms. I have started solving Love Babbar DSA Cracker sheet ... dundee train times

Generate permutations with only adjacent swaps allowed

Category:Minimum Swaps to Sort Practice GeeksforGeeks

Tags:Permutation swaps gfg

Permutation swaps gfg

Previous Permutation With One Swap in Python

WebYou have these elements that are not in their original positions and you want them to be in the right places. But when you start to make swaps, you should always draw a new picture for every swap to track what's going on. Yesterday's global round featured this problem about permutations. WebApr 1, 2024 · Permutes the range [first, last) into the next permutation, where the set of all permutations is ordered lexicographically with respect to operator< or comp. Returns true if such a "next permutation" exists; otherwise transforms the range into the lexicographically first permutation (as if by std::sort (first, last, comp)) and returns false .

Permutation swaps gfg

Did you know?

WebThe total number of swaps is the length of the permutation (6) minus the number of cycles (3). Given any two permutations, the distance between them is equivalent to the distance between the composition of the first with the inverse of the second and the identity (computed as explained above). WebApr 30, 2024 · Previous Permutation With One Swap in Python. Suppose we have an array A of positive integers (not necessarily unique), we have to find the lexicographically largest …

WebThe total number of swaps is the length of the permutation (6) minus the number of cycles (3). Given any two permutations, the distance between them is equivalent to the distance … WebPermutations in array Basic Accuracy: 60.7% Submissions: 13K+ Points: 1 Given two arrays of equal size N and an integer K. The task is to check if after permuting both arrays, we …

WebGFG Weekly Coding Contest. Job-a-Thon: Hiring Challenge. Upcoming. BiWizard School Contest. Gate CS Scholarship Test. Solving for India Hack-a-thon. All Contest and Events. POTD. Sign In. Problems Courses Get Hired; Hiring. Contests. GFG Weekly Coding Contest. Job-a-Thon: Hiring Challenge. Upcoming. WebOct 20, 2024 · Explanation 2: As A != B you have to perform operations on A but there is only good pair available i,e (2, 4) so if you swap A2 with A4 you get A = [1, 4, 2, 3] which is equal to B so we will...

WebLargest Permutation Practice GeeksforGeeks Given a permutation of first n natural numbers as an array and an integer k. Print the lexicographically largest permutation after at most k swaps. Input: n=5 k=3 arr[] = {4, 5, 2, 1, 3} Output: 5 4 3 2 1 Explanation: Swap 1st ProblemsCoursesSALEGet Hired Contests GFG Weekly Coding Contest

WebA permutation of an array of integers is an arrangement of its members into a sequence or linear order. For example, for arr = [1,2,3], the following are all the permutations of arr: [1,2,3], [1,3,2], [2, 1, 3], [2, 3, 1], [3,1,2], [3,2,1]. dundee translation serviceWebNov 4, 2024 · Generate permutations with only adjacent swaps allowed. Given a string on length N. You can swap only the adjacent elements and each element can be swapped atmost once. Find the no of permutations of the string that can be generated after … A password is said to be strong if it satisfies the following criteria: . It contains at l… dundee travelodge strathmore avenueWebPermutation Swaps Nishant Rana Last Updated: Aug 4, 2024 Share : Introduction: You are given the permutation of unique numbers from 1 to N in the initial array(a) and the final … dundee truck parts ohioWebJul 11, 2024 · GFG Sheets. Web Dev Cheat Sheets. HTML Cheat Sheet; CSS Cheat Sheet ... Using the default library itertools function permutations. permutations function will create all the permutations of a given string and then ... that is greater than str[i – 1] and swap its position with str[i – 1]. This is then the next permutation. Python3 # import ... dundee trick or treating 2022WebSep 4, 2024 · View sanjeevpep1coding's solution of Minimum Possible Integer After at Most K Adjacent Swaps On Digits on LeetCode, the world's largest programming community. dundee treasure huntWebKevin wants to get a permutation Q. Also he believes that there are M good pairs of integers (ai , bi). Kevin can perform following operation with his permutation: Swap P x and P y … dundee t shirtsWebSwap Permutation. How many sequences (S1) can you get after exact k adjacent swaps on A? How many sequences (S2) can you get after at most k swaps on A? An adjacent swap … dundee trophy